Transaction 90780a3dd00f423756973026f0150343d1e90eda94e9e3dc010815d6c95a1e37

1 Input
2 Outputs
  • 90780a3dd00f423756973026f0150343d1e90eda94e9e3dc010815d6c95a1e37:0
  • value  622449
    address  3FTZF5aZpq9inwXGaCWPwEcsyyyGrWzFmJ
  • 90780a3dd00f423756973026f0150343d1e90eda94e9e3dc010815d6c95a1e37:1
  • value  6489793297
    address  bc1qrnn4wfhgz2e0etek66sh3n9l6k99alxk044mhr